Kerry Stokes is an Australian businessman and billionaire, best known as the executive chairman of Seven Group Holdings, who has been involved in financing legal proceedings for Ben Roberts-Smith in his defamation case against major Australian newspapers.

Born on Jul 13, 1940 (85 years old)
